Mnuchin Hopes To Soon Reach "Final Round" Of China Trade Talks

Description

Treasury Secretary Steven Mnuchin said Saturday a U.S.-China trade agreement would go “way beyond” previous efforts to open China’s markets to U.S. companies. Reuters reports he added that he hoped that the two nations were “close to the final round” of negotiations. Mnuchin and U.S. Trade Representative Robert Lighthizer are set to hold two calls next week with Chinese Vice Premier Liu He.
